EatSmart Nutrition Scale

The EatSmart Nutrition Scale is the only scale on the market that includes a Nutrition Facts Calculator mode that allows you to determine the nutritional content of foods that come in packages, boxes, cans and other labeled containers.“

By entering the serving size and Nutrition Fact from the label it will calculate the nutritional value for the portion placed on the scale.

Why Is Obesity A Growing Problem in America?

The statistics have been reported in all the major news magazines, on the nightly news and in newspapers from coast to coast. Overall, adult men and women are about 8 pounds heavier, on average, than they were 15 years ago. According to the National Institutes of Health, over 100 million Americans – or about 60 percent of the adult population – are overweight. Find out why.
